1. How Many Yorubas are in Canada?

.

Did you know that Canadians of Yoruba heritage make up the largest ethnic Nigerian community in Canada? According to the 2021 Canadian census by Statistics Canada, the number of Canadian residents speaking Yoruba at home is 26,305, making it the most spoken Niger-Congo language in the country.
